Activities 1. Budget Air Budget Air(BA) has received numerous customer complaints about customer service. A fact finding exercise revealed the following facts - BA has an online system for sales of tickets, online check-in. - most customers do online check-in as that are under the impression that it is faster than manual check-in. - usually there are 5 counters for checking in - the 1st counter is labelled Document check while the others are labeled baggage drop. - customers who have done on line check-in are initially happy when they arrive at airport as there are 4 counters for baggage drop. - The shortest queue is document check counter. Customers who have NOT checked in online proceed to that counter. Customers who have lined up for 30 min on the shortest queue leave in disgust as they are told to do self check in at the new self service kiosk. - if they have check in baggage, they are still asked to proceed to baggage drop upon completing the self check in. -customers are observed complaining that the checkin is 10 min per person on average for baggage drop - customers who have done online checkin are then given a boarding pass to replace the on line checkin document. - there are 10 self serve kiosk for self checkin at airport but some customers need help so 3 staff are standing around to provide assistance. - BA would announce for customers whose flight would be flying in 30 min to proceed to emergency check in at the 6th counter. Customers who arrive late fume while fretting they would miss their flight for a good hour before this happens. - 1 customer complained that the online checkin documents included baggage barcodes which the checkin officer asked the customer to put in a label that is tied onto bag handle. The officer took 1 min to scan and rescan the bar code and finally saw that the system had errorneously printed the baggage barcodes for to flight and not the return flight. Baggage officer then requested the print of the Barcode Labels which was a procedure used in the system before the current one. In teams of 3 or 4, A. Discuss on the work flow above, and identify the process issues B. The above situation requires BPM. Explain BPM. Is that the same as Business Process modelling? C.
